RompeRatones Posted November 26, 2004 Posted November 26, 2004 I see that when i go to the admin(*) folder i dont need to be logged in as an administrator, so i password protected the admin/index.php archive with a php script. Is there a function to require to log in as an administrator for acquiring acess to this folder? (*) actually i renamed that folder to a secret name

♥Vger Posted November 26, 2004 Posted November 26, 2004 Easiest way to do this is to use your web hosting control panel to 'Password Protect' that directory - and it sets up the .htpassword, and adds the entry into the .htaccess file for you. Vger
